Özet

Efficient conversion of the PV energy requires better hardware and software solutions. Apart from efficient power structures, microinverters should have control algorithms like maxinmm power tracking and phase locked loop (PLL). In this study, an overview of push-pull based microinverter and its control structure is presented. PLL structure is given with a mathematical background and it is simulated for different cases using MATLAB. PLL algorithms are implemented in a microcontroller and they compared with experimental results. Experimental results are in agreement with the simulation results.
